Is it possible to connect a pc with a mac, so that I´ll be able to transfer data from mac to pc?

Hi, I've done this using PC Maclan. It's not very difficult, but keep in mind that if you're connecting two machines directly you'll need an ethernet crossover cable, rather than the regular ethernet cable you'd use to connect to a network. The demo version of PC Maclan is pretty functional, so you might as well try it out.
Another thing to keep in mind is that any networking will require the use of AppleTalk, which will not work at the same time as OMS, so for music applications a sneakernet solution (two zip drives, cd burners?) might be necessary anyway. Now if I've made a mistake with that point please correct me, as I'm looking for a better solution myself. Any experience with DAVE or MacSOHO?
